InfoComm 2007 Hot Products

At this year's InfoComm, although many manufacturers continued the trend of product-line extensions and feature enhancements, there was a marked increase in the number of truly new products and innovation.

In our 2006 edition of Pro AV's InfoComm Hot Products, we noted an overall trend of “nearly new, improved and simplified” items among the 770 exhibitors at the expo. Among the usual fare of excellent educational programs, special events, and pavilions, the record-breaking 31,000 attendees at the Anaheim Convention Center in California didn't have to go far to see some really exciting technologies.

Each year, Pro AV enlists a select group of contributors, industry experts, consultants, and our own editors to submit nominations for the products they saw at InfoComm that excited attendees, and could be significant products with a potential positive impact on the pro AV business.
